Explorar o código

use mol2 mol_name for entity name when available

Alexander Rose %!s(int64=4) %!d(string=hai) anos
pai
achega
e49af151c1
Modificáronse 1 ficheiros con 1 adicións e 1 borrados
  1. 1 1
      src/mol-model-formats/structure/mol2.ts

+ 1 - 1
src/mol-model-formats/structure/mol2.ts

@@ -48,7 +48,7 @@ async function getModels(mol2: Mol2File, ctx: RuntimeContext): Promise<Model[]>
         }, atoms.count);
         }, atoms.count);
 
 
         const entityBuilder = new EntityBuilder();
         const entityBuilder = new EntityBuilder();
-        entityBuilder.setNames([['MOL', 'Unknown Entity']]);
+        entityBuilder.setNames([['MOL', molecule.mol_name || 'Unknown Entity']]);
         entityBuilder.getEntityId('MOL', MoleculeType.Unknown, 'A');
         entityBuilder.getEntityId('MOL', MoleculeType.Unknown, 'A');
 
 
         const componentBuilder = new ComponentBuilder(atoms.subst_id, atoms.atom_name);
         const componentBuilder = new ComponentBuilder(atoms.subst_id, atoms.atom_name);